There’s a new Google Search for Android app rolling out today in the Google Play Store. The new app brings a host of new features, improvements and enhancements. The usual slew of bug fixes and performance improvements are present as always. This update is limited to those Android devices that are running version 4.1 or higher.

The new Google Search app for Android is now able to show information about TV shows that a user watches on their internet connected TV. However this feature is only available to users in the U.S. only. Both the device and the internet connected TV must be on the same network for this feature to work. New voice action tips also make their way on this update, and through a new voice action, users will now be able to play music from their device on the Play Store. The app itself allows uers to quickly search the web as well as their Android device. The app is also capable of giving personalized results based on the user’s location. You can download the updated Google Search for Android app now from Google Play Store.
